Automated Model Atmosphere Generator Program (AMAG)

Abstract

This paper documents a computer program for generating internally consistent model atmosphere data based on a terrain following five-layer temperature model derived from the 1976 U.S. Standard Atmosphere and the 1966 U. S. Standard Atmosphere Supplements. For any given geometric altitude, terrain height, ground level temperature and altimeter setting, the Automated Model Atmosphere Generator (AMAG) program will calculate corresponding temperature and pressure altitude values. From these two output parameters the user can compute additional environmental parameters needed to solve particular engineering problems.
